TurmericTurmeric settled up 0.03% at 6580 on improved demand at lower levels supported the sentiments. Emerging spot demand, restricted arrivals of quality turmeric and next year crop concern also supported prices. However improved weather conditions in the growing areas in AP and TN limited the upside. Hybrid turmeric prices increased due to higher demand. Better quality also helped growers fetch higher price for the variety. Many traders expected some fresh demand from North India, but that has not happened in Erode. Hence, they quoted a lower price. They are expecting fresh orders in September. But the demand for the hybrid finger turmeric has increased and so the traders after inspecting the hybrid turmeric quoted increased price, have purchased all the 150 bags. This is due to its quality. In Nizamabad Total arrivals are at 2000 quintals, down by 500 quintals as compared to previous day. In Sangli estimated market supply was at 500 quintals, lower by 300 quintals from previous day's arrivals. Some demand is likely to come in for all grades at lower levels as stockiest are likely to hoard and sale when exporters move into the market. After some days quality turmeric arrived for sale and the traders quoted higher price and procured the turmeric to fulfil their local orders. In Nizamabad, a major spot market in AP, the price ended at 6168.4 rupees gained 72.95 rupees.
